Pick The Right Gemstone
Diamonds aren’t the only option when it comes to luxury engagement rings. While a classic diamond is still a popular choice, don’t shy away from sapphires, rubies, emeralds, or even Moissanite for a more personal touch. Each stone has its own personality.
Sapphires come in a stunning range of colours and are incredibly durable. Emeralds, with their deep green hue, make a striking statement but are a bit more delicate. Rubies, known for their fiery red tones, symbolise passion and love. Moissanite gives off a diamond-like sparkle at a more affordable price and is a great ethical option.
Think about both beauty and practicality. Some gemstones are tougher than others, so consider how they’ll hold up over time. A stone that’s more prone to scratches might not be the best choice for someone who’s always on the go.
Choose A Setting That Shows Off The Gemstone
The setting is where the magic happens – it’s what showcases the gemstone and gives the ring its overall personality. Whether you go for a classic solitaire, a halo design, or something vintage-inspired, the setting should enhance the gem, not overpower it. For example, a round stone looks incredible in a simple solitaire, while an oval or cushion-cut gem can shine beautifully in a halo setting.
The metal you choose for the band also makes a difference. Platinum and white gold are classics for a reason: they’re sleek, durable and timeless. If you want something a bit warmer, yellow or rose gold can add a personal touch and set the ring apart. Just make sure the metal complements both the gemstone and your partner’s taste.
Think About The Long Term
An engagement ring will be a symbol for years, if not generations. Opt for quality craftsmanship and materials that will last, not just follow the latest trend. You want a ring that’ll stay as beautiful and meaningful in 20 years as it is right now.
Also, think about how much care the ring might need. Some gemstones require more attention than others, so it’s worth talking to your jeweller about maintenance options, like cleaning and resizing, to keep the ring in top condition.
